It used to be that you needed to go to college, maybe graduate school, and work a similar job for the rest of your career. Many even used to stay at the same company for the length of their career. With democratized knowledge – thanks to the internet – and the rise of online learning platforms, the ability to learn and acquire new skills is more easily accessible and can help you pivot your career path at any time.
